The Riot Act was an act of the Parliament of Great Britain which authorised local authorities to declare any group of twelve or more people to be unlawfully assembled and thus have to disperse or face punitive action. The long title of the act was: An Act for preventing tumults and riotous assemblies and for the more speedy and effectual punishing the rioters.

The idiom "read the riot act" means to issue a stern warning or reprimand to someone, usually in a forceful or direct manner. It comes from a historical practice where a formal proclamation known as the Riot Act was read aloud to disperse unruly crowds or protests.
